The best upsets are the ones no one sees coming.

Northern Illinois’ stunning defeat of Notre Dame certainly fit the bill. Just a week ago, the Irish looked like a surefire playoff team after upending Texas A&M on the road

The best upsets aren’t about luck.

There was nothing unconventional in NIU’s game plan. The Huskies were the more physical, more fundamentally sound, more deserving team Saturday.

The best upsets cast our collective conscious backward, toward the other moments when the seemingly impossible suddenly became real.

In this case, NIU didn’t have to work too hard. Notre Dame’s good for one of these every few years.

It was a fitting release for a nation primed for chaos after Saturday’s early slate teased so many near misses.

In New Orleans, Tulane had No. 17 Kansas State on the ropes well into the second half, and only a controversial penalty kept the Green Wave from tying the game in the final moment.
